===== Manifest ===== Initially born at the SHA2017 **/dev/base**'s mission is to provide an open, inclusive and creative platform for hackers, makers, tinkerers and other (also normal) people who want to hack, create, make and learn. \\ The original **/dev/base** orga team, consisting of trinitor, faker, aldarys, weedwood and n00ne strongly believe in free and open information, the network effect in collective projects and having fun while working together. \\ **/dev/base** provides a shared workspace, a strong IT infrastructure, an open-minded and creative collective with a wide and deep skill-set and a constant Mate-flow. \\ **/dev/base** is a hub for a bunch of [[events:start|events]] and hosts a lot of different [[projects:start|projects]]. **/dev/base** welcomes open-minded, creative, nice and fun people with an interest in learning and trying out new stuff who want to take an active part. We are not political, we are technological.
